How do you feel about maps?
The beauty of maps is their ability to visualize data in ways that surface perspectives you might otherwise miss.
Here is an article series that talks about “walkability rules” and highlights where we are currently at in Wichita, things like:
There are 1103 bus stops in Wichita, but more than 84% of them do not have benches
Pocket parks in the 1970s led to NE Wichita residents having better access to green spaces than the rest of the city
~35% of all land area downtown is devoted to parking

Polling Locations Reassigned
Some polling locations for Wichita’s March 3 special election will change after Sedgwick County officials announced that 11 regular polling sites are unavailable, impacting about 26,000 voters and increasing election costs by $20,000 to mail updated location postcards.
The City of Wichita will cover the total $170,000 cost of the election from the City Manager’s contingency budget. City Council previously approved the March 3 election on a proposed sales tax, with a public workshop scheduled for January 27 at City Hall to discuss how funds would be managed if the measure passes.
